Maintenance Tips for Waste Disposal Trucks – A comprehensive look
Maintenance tips for waste disposal trucks help you keep your fleet reliable, safe, and cost-effective. Waste trucks work under heavy pressure every day. They deal with stop-start driving, heavy loads, hydraulic lifting, compaction systems, wet waste, dust, and rough working conditions.
If you hire, manage, or operate waste disposal trucks, regular maintenance protects your vehicle, your driver, and your collection schedule. A small fault in the hydraulic system, brakes, tyres, or compactor can quickly turn into a costly breakdown.
This guide covers practical waste truck maintenance steps you can use to reduce downtime and keep your vehicles working for longer.
Why waste disposal truck maintenance matters
Waste trucks are not ordinary heavy vehicles. They spend most of the day stopping, starting, lifting, compacting, and moving under load. That places extra strain on the engine, transmission, brakes, suspension, tyres, hydraulics, and electrical system.
A planned maintenance routine helps you:
- reduce breakdowns during collection routes
- lower repair costs
- extend the working life of your trucks
- improve fuel use
- protect drivers and pedestrians
- keep your waste collection schedule on track
- spot faults before they become serious
Use daily pre-trip and post-trip checks
Daily checks are one of the easiest ways to prevent downtime. Drivers should inspect the truck before leaving the yard and again when the truck returns.
Check fluid levels
Check engine oil, coolant, brake fluid, transmission fluid, diesel exhaust fluid, and hydraulic fluid. Low fluid levels can point to leaks, worn seals, or poor servicing. Do not ignore fresh marks under the truck.
Inspect tyres
Check tyre pressure, tread depth, sidewall damage, cuts, bulges, and objects stuck in the tread. Waste trucks often work near curbs, building sites, industrial yards, and uneven surfaces, so tyre damage is common.
Test lights and alarms
Brake lights, indicators, reverse lights, beacons, warning alarms, and cameras should work before the truck leaves the yard. These parts matter in tight streets, busy sites, and collection areas with pedestrians.
Check the body and loading area
Inspect the hopper, tailgate, steps, handles, bin lifters, guards, and compaction area. Look for cracks, loose bolts, damaged hinges, leaking hoses, or blocked moving parts.
| Daily check | What to look for | Why it matters |
|---|---|---|
| Engine oil | Low level, dirty oil, leaks | Protects the engine from wear |
| Hydraulic fluid | Low level, foaming, leaks | Keeps lifting and compaction working |
| Tyres | Pressure, tread, damage | Improves safety and fuel use |
| Lights and alarms | Faulty bulbs or warning systems | Protects workers and road users |
Keep the engine in good condition
The engine handles long hours, heavy loads, idling, and frequent acceleration. Poor engine maintenance leads to higher fuel use, power loss, overheating, and avoidable repairs.
Change oil at the correct interval
Use the oil grade listed by the manufacturer. Waste trucks often work in harsh conditions, so they may need shorter oil change intervals than vehicles doing light highway work.
Replace filters on schedule
Air filters, oil filters, and fuel filters protect the engine from dirt and poor fuel flow. Dirty filters make the engine work harder and can reduce fuel efficiency.
Watch coolant and temperature
Check coolant level, radiator condition, hoses, clamps, and fan operation. Overheating can cause major engine damage, especially during summer or on heavy commercial routes.
Service the hydraulic system
The hydraulic system is one of the most important parts of a waste disposal truck. It powers the compactor, bin lifters, tailgate, and other moving components.
Hydraulic faults can stop a truck from working, even if the engine is fine.
Inspect hoses and fittings
Look for leaks, cracks, rubbing, swelling, loose fittings, and damaged protective sleeves. A hydraulic hose can fail under pressure, so small signs of wear need fast attention.
Check hydraulic cylinders
Inspect chrome rods, seals, mounts, and pins. Scored rods and leaking seals reduce system power and can damage other parts.
Keep hydraulic fluid clean
Dirty hydraulic fluid causes wear inside pumps, valves, and cylinders. Replace filters and fluid according to the service schedule. Slow lifting, weak compaction, and noisy hydraulic operation are warning signs.
Maintain the compaction system
The compactor does the hard work of compressing waste inside the truck body. If it becomes slow, noisy, or weak, the truck carries less waste and may need more trips to the disposal site.
Check and service:
- packer blades
- guide rails
- rollers
- pivot pins
- pressure valves
- hydraulic cylinders
- wear plates
Grease moving parts on schedule. Remove debris from tracks and loading areas. A blocked or dry compaction system increases strain on the hydraulic pump.
Look after the transmission
Waste disposal trucks often work in stop-start conditions. This creates heat and load in the transmission.
Watch for:
- slow gear changes
- slipping gears
- grinding or whining sounds
- transmission fluid leaks
- a burning smell
- poor acceleration under load
Check the transmission fluid level and condition. Use the correct fluid type. Heavy commercial routes may need more frequent transmission servicing than lighter work.
Inspect brakes often
Brakes are under heavy stress on waste collection routes. These trucks stop often and carry heavy loads, so brake wear can happen fast.
Check pads, drums, discs, and rotors
Look for worn pads, scoring, cracks, heat marks, and uneven wear. Squealing, grinding, vibration, or longer stopping distances need attention.
Check air brake or hydraulic brake systems
Depending on the truck, inspect brake lines, chambers, fluid, air dryers, valves, and fittings. Moisture and leaks can reduce braking performance.
| Brake part | Warning sign | Action |
|---|---|---|
| Pads or shoes | Squealing, grinding, low thickness | Replace before damage spreads |
| Rotors or drums | Heat marks, scoring, vibration | Inspect, machine, or replace |
| Brake lines | Leaks, cracking, corrosion | Repair before route use |
| Air dryer | Moisture in air system | Service or replace cartridge |
Check the suspension system
The suspension helps carry heavy waste loads and keeps the truck stable. It also affects tyre wear, steering, braking, and driver comfort.
Inspect:
- leaf springs
- air bags
- shock absorbers
- bushings
- mounts
- axle alignment
Warning signs include sagging, uneven ride height, swaying, clunking noises, and uneven tyre wear. These faults can affect load control and road safety.
Maintain the electrical system
Modern waste trucks use electrical systems for lights, sensors, cameras, control panels, telematics, safety systems, and hydraulic controls.
Check the battery
Inspect terminals, cables, mounting brackets, and charge condition. Clean corrosion and tighten loose connections.
Inspect wiring
Look for chafed insulation, exposed wires, loose plugs, water ingress, and damaged harnesses. Wiring near moving parts or metal edges needs extra attention.
Use a tyre management plan
Tyres affect safety, fuel use, and running costs. Waste trucks often drive near curbs, rubble, sharp objects, and heavy site entrances.
Your tyre plan should include:
- regular pressure checks
- tread depth checks
- rotation where suitable
- alignment checks
- inspection for cuts and bulges
- matching tyres to the truck’s route type
Use heavy-duty tyres suited to the truck’s load and working environment. Poor tyre management can increase fuel costs and raise the risk of blowouts.
Keep waste disposal trucks clean
Cleaning is part of maintenance. Waste residue, chemicals, liquids, mud, and road grime can cause corrosion and hide faults.
Wash the hopper and rear body
The hopper and compaction area collect wet waste and corrosive material. Wash these areas often to reduce rust and make inspections easier.
Clean around hydraulic parts
Clean hydraulic hoses, cylinders, and fittings so you can spot leaks early. Dirt and old oil can hide problems.
Keep the cab clean
A clean cab supports driver comfort and helps drivers notice warning lights, damaged switches, and loose controls.
Schedule professional inspections
Drivers and in-house teams can handle basic checks, but some repairs need qualified heavy vehicle mechanics. Waste trucks have specialist hydraulic, electrical, and compaction systems.
Call a professional when you notice:
- loss of hydraulic pressure
- recurring electrical faults
- brake performance changes
- transmission problems
- engine warning lights
- unusual compactor movement
- structural cracks or tailgate alignment problems
Choose a mechanic or workshop with experience in commercial waste vehicles, not only general trucks.
Follow manufacturer service schedules
The manufacturer’s manual should guide your maintenance plan. Different truck models, bodies, engines, and hydraulic systems have different service needs.
Keep a service record for each vehicle. Track:
- inspection dates
- reported faults
- oil and filter changes
- hydraulic servicing
- brake work
- tyre replacements
- professional inspection reports
Digital maintenance records make it easier to plan repairs, order parts, and prove the truck has been maintained.
Prepare for seasonal changes
Waste truck maintenance should change with the weather. Cold, heat, rain, and dust all affect truck performance.
Winter maintenance tips
- test battery strength
- check antifreeze levels
- inspect fuel lines for moisture
- use fuel additives where needed
- check tyre condition for wet or icy roads
- inspect lights and warning systems more often
Summer maintenance tips
- check coolant and radiator condition
- monitor hydraulic fluid temperature
- clean radiator fins
- inspect tyres for heat-related pressure changes
- watch for overheating during heavy routes
Make maintenance more sustainable
Good waste truck maintenance also reduces environmental impact. A well-serviced truck burns fuel more efficiently and produces fewer avoidable emissions.
Greener servicing habits include:
- disposing of used oil and fluids correctly
- recycling filters, batteries, and tyres where possible
- fixing leaks quickly
- using approved lubricants and fluids
- reducing unnecessary idling
- keeping engines and emission systems serviced
These steps help reduce waste from the maintenance process itself.

Frequently asked questions
How often should hydraulic systems on waste disposal trucks be checked?
Hydraulic fluid levels should be checked daily. Hoses, fittings, cylinders, filters, and pressure performance should be inspected on a planned service schedule based on the manufacturer’s recommendations.
What is the most important daily check on a waste truck?
Fluid levels, tyres, brakes, lights, and hydraulic leaks should all be checked before the truck starts work.
Why does cleaning matter for garbage truck maintenance?
Cleaning removes corrosive waste residue and makes it easier to see leaks, cracks, worn parts, and damaged hydraulic components.
How can maintenance improve fuel use?
Clean filters, correct tyre pressure, serviced injectors, good wheel alignment, and reduced idling all help lower fuel consumption.
When should you use professional refuse truck servicing?
Use a specialist mechanic for hydraulic pressure loss, transmission faults, brake problems, electrical faults, compactor issues, and structural damage.
What should be included in a waste truck maintenance checklist?
A checklist should include fluids, tyres, brakes, lights, hydraulics, compactor parts, suspension, electrical systems, cleaning, and service records.
How do seasons affect waste truck maintenance?
Cold weather affects batteries, fuel, coolant, and tyres. Hot weather affects cooling systems, hydraulic fluid, tyres, and engine temperature.
